Hi all, im new to this and also new to the skyline family, i have an r34, and the battery went dead, so no big deal. i bought a charger as the battery appears quite new, but it wouldn't hold the charge.. so now im thinking give it another charge, then take it for a good long drive say 45 mins or so to charge battery but is that doesn't work..where or what brand would be recommended for me? any help would be great, cheers

Before you replace the battery, I would suggest you check that the voltage regulator - in the alternator - is functioning correctly (do a search for how to do that). Otherwise you risk stuffing another battery.
